The cause of hurting must be identified before it can be dealt with. Chiropractic care will begin with a careful evaluation. Questions help to pinpoint the location and severity that exists.
The individual is examined physically and x-rays may be required. It will be determined how far the head can be turned and lifted up or down. This is important in whiplash accidents.
Massage can be one way to relieve the pain of tension headaches. Tense muscles may also respond to manual spinal adjustments. The spinal column is composed of small, hollow bones called vertebrae.
Muscles, ligaments and tendons surround the small bones. If these adjoining tissues are tight that may cause the head to hurt. Some gentle exercises can be used in the home.
Hormones are thought to play a part in many headaches classified as migraines. These usually affect one side of the head. They are often accompanied by an upset stomach.
Sitting in a cool, dark room is sometimes the only way to combat one of these. Massage may have some benefits. There are new medications on the market that show promise.
A concussion might leave someone with reoccurring headaches. A subluxation of the spinal column might also be at fault. This is a misalignment of the vertebrae, which causes pressure on the adjacent nerves.
A whiplash injury, which affects the neck, is caused by a jerking of the head, forward and then back rapidly. It can happen in a car crash. The seven cervical vertebrae may be misaligned due to the jerking motion.
The pain of headaches can be alleviated through chiropractic care. The improvement in the range of motion of the head will also improve. There is hope for a medication-free and non-invasive way to battle the agony of sporadic or chronic headache pain.
